Our Hoarding Cleanup Process

Site Inspection & Testing

Identify contamination hotspots with specialized equipment

Containment

Isolate affected zones to prevent airborne spread

Contaminant Removal

Dispose of carpets, pad, flooring, drywall, and insulation, as needed

Surface Decontamination

Neutralize hazardous residues from all surfaces

Air & Odor Treatment

Use an ozone machine to remove lingering vapors and odors

Final Clearance

Confirm remediation has been fully completed
